H04N1/32352

Parameter adjustments based on strength change

In an example, a capture system includes a content capture mechanism, an isolation engine, a mark strength engine, and a parameter controller. In that example, the isolation engine generates mark data, the mark strength engine identifies a first variance level in a first region of a first set of mark data, and the parameter controller adjusts a parameter of the content capture mechanism in accordance with a strength change based on a comparison of the first variance level to a second variance level in a first region of a second set of mark data.

METHOD AND APPARATUS FOR DIGITAL WATERMARKING OF THREE DIMENSIONAL OBJECT
20200175641 · 2020-06-04 · ·

In one embodiment, a method for 3D digital watermarking for a triangular mesh using one or more key parameters is disclosed including forming a Hamiltonian path of a desired length around a selected vertex in a selected direction of a spiral; marking the selected vertex a dead end if there is a deadlock and continuing the spiral; and applying a watermark by introducing points in a path order on edges of the spiral, wherein information is encoded at a partition of adjacent triangles at one or more of the points.

EMBEDDING PROCEDURES ON DIGITAL IMAGES AS METADATA
20200153995 · 2020-05-14 ·

A first digital image is integrated into a second digital image to generate a third digital image. A first code representing the procedures performed to integrate the first digital image into the second digital image is generated. A second code representing information for retrieving the first digital image is generated. The first code and the second code are embedded as metadata into a file that contains the second digital image.

ENCODING PRINTED GRAYSCALE IMAGES
20200134404 · 2020-04-30 ·

In an example method, a dot pattern of pixels including information to be encoded across an image is mapped to a corresponding subset of the grayscale source pixels corresponding to the image to be printed. A value of a grayscale pixel in the subset of the grayscale source pixels is modified based on based on a predetermined threshold pixel value. The value of the grayscale pixel is decreased in response to detecting that the predetermined threshold pixel value is exceeded. The clipping channel color is used to detect the dot pattern of pixels. The image including the subset of pixels with modified values is printed.

Hierarchical watermark detector

The present invention relates generally to digital watermarking. One aspect of the disclosure includes a method comprising: obtaining data representing imagery; using one or more configured processors, analyzing a plurality of portions of the data to detect a redundantly embedded watermark signal, the analyzing producing detection statistics for each of the plurality of portions, the detection statistics comprising a payload signature, a rotation angle and a scale factor for each portion of the plurality of portions; accumulating payload signatures based on compatible rotation angles and scale factors, said accumulating yielding an accumulated payload signature; and decoding a plural-bit payload from the accumulated payload signature. Of course, many other aspects and disclosure are provided in this patent document.

Method of securely transmitting an image from an electronic identity document to a terminal
10582083 · 2020-03-03 · ·

The invention relates to systems and methods of securely transmitting an image stored in the memory of an identity document to a first terminal that is suitable for receiving the image. In various implementations, operations are performed by the identity document, including the identity document receiving an attribute transmitted by the first terminal; generating a marker from the attribute received from the terminal; including the marker in the image; and transmitting the image containing the marker, which may be referred to as the modified image, to the terminal.

Method and system for providing watermark to subscribers

A method for providing watermark to subscribers is provided. The method comprises observing a request for a first content from a subscriber, determining if the subscriber can receive a watermark, generating a second content comprising the watermark if the subscriber can receive a watermark, causing the subscriber to fetch the first content, and causing the subscriber to fetch the second content comprising the watermark overlaying the first content.

Signal encoding for physical objects including dark ink

This disclosure relates to advanced image signal processing technology including encoded signals and digital watermarking. One implementation is directed a printed object comprising: a substrate comprising a first area; a first colored ink or design printed within the first area, the first colored ink or design comprising a spectral reflectivity of less than or equal to 20% at or around 660 nm; a colored ink mixture printed over the first colored ink or design at a first plurality of spatial locations within the first area, the colored ink mixture printed such that the first area comprises a second plurality of spatial locations without the colored ink mixture, the colored ink mixture comprising opaque white ink and a first colorant, wherein the color ink mixture comprises a spectral reflectivity greater than the first colored ink or design at or around 660 nm, and wherein colored ink mixture comprises a spectral reflectivity less than the first colored ink or design in the range of 495 nm-570 nm; in which the first plurality of spatial locations is arranged in a pattern conveying an encoded signal, and in which the first colored ink or design and the colored ink mixture comprise a spectral reflectivity difference at or around 660 nm in a difference range of 8%-30%. Of course, other objects, methods, packages, labels, containers, systems and apparatus are described in this patent document.

System and Method of Displaying Watermarks

In one or more embodiments, one or more systems, methods, and/or processes may redirect a request to open a document to a background process that controls access to the document; may determine policy information associated with the document and a user of an application; may provide the document to the application; may determine an area of a user interface of the application that displays information of the document; may determine watermark information based at least on the policy information; may generate one or more watermarks based at least on the watermark information; and may display the one or more watermarks, based at least on the watermark information, on the area of the user interface of the application that displays the information of the document.

Device and method for recording a document exhibiting a marking
10516801 · 2019-12-24 · ·

The device (10) for recording a document (130, 135) exhibiting a marking (132) produced by a stamp comprising at least one relief for successive contacting with a pigment and a surface of a document to be marked, one form of at least one said relief being representative of: a separator identifying a first page of the document, a user identifier; and/or an alphanumeric item of information parameterized by a user,
comprises: an image sensor (105) for digitizing the document into at least one image, a detector (110) of the marking on at least one digitized image, a means (115) for reading the information, the marking, representative of: the user identifier; and the alphanumeric item of information; and a means (120) for recording the digitized document as a function of the information read.